本文目录导读:
概述
随着互联网、大数据、云计算等技术的飞速发展,分布式存储技术应运而生,分布式存储是一种将数据分散存储在多个节点上的存储方式,具有高可靠性、高可用性、高扩展性等特点,本文将深入解析分布式存储的五大核心特征。
图片来源于网络,如有侵权联系删除
分布式存储的五大核心特征
1、高可靠性
分布式存储系统通过将数据分散存储在多个节点上,有效避免了单点故障,在单个节点出现故障时,系统仍能正常运行,确保数据的安全性和可靠性,以下是实现高可靠性的几个关键因素:
(1)冗余设计:分布式存储系统采用冗余设计,如RAID技术,将数据分散存储在多个磁盘上,提高数据的可靠性。
(2)数据备份:定期对数据进行备份,确保在数据丢失或损坏时,可以快速恢复。
(3)故障检测与恢复:系统具备故障检测机制,及时发现并处理故障,确保数据安全。
2、高可用性
分布式存储系统采用多节点集群架构,通过负载均衡、故障转移等技术,确保系统在高并发环境下仍能稳定运行,以下是实现高可用性的几个关键因素:
(1)负载均衡:通过负载均衡技术,将请求均匀分配到各个节点,避免单点过载。
(2)故障转移:在节点故障时,自动将请求转移到其他正常节点,确保系统持续提供服务。
图片来源于网络,如有侵权联系删除
(3)集群管理:通过集群管理工具,实时监控集群状态,及时发现并处理问题。
3、高扩展性
分布式存储系统可根据需求动态扩展存储容量,满足不同场景下的存储需求,以下是实现高扩展性的几个关键因素:
(1)横向扩展:通过增加节点数量,实现存储容量的线性增长。
(2)弹性扩展:在系统运行过程中,可动态调整存储容量,满足业务需求。
(3)自动化扩展:系统具备自动扩展功能,根据负载情况自动增加节点。
4、高性能
分布式存储系统采用并行处理、数据压缩、数据去重等技术,提高数据读写速度,以下是实现高性能的几个关键因素:
(1)并行处理:通过并行处理技术,提高数据读写效率。
图片来源于网络,如有侵权联系删除
(2)数据压缩:对数据进行压缩,减少存储空间占用,提高读写速度。
(3)数据去重:识别并删除重复数据,提高存储效率。
5、灵活性
分布式存储系统支持多种存储协议和接口,可满足不同业务场景的需求,以下是实现灵活性的几个关键因素:
(1)支持多种存储协议:如NFS、SMB、iSCSI等,满足不同业务场景的需求。
(2)支持多种接口:如API、SDK等,方便用户进行开发和应用。
(3)兼容性:与现有系统兼容,降低迁移成本。
分布式存储技术具有高可靠性、高可用性、高扩展性、高性能和灵活性等特点,成为现代数据中心存储解决方案的重要选择,在云计算、大数据等领域的应用日益广泛,为我国信息化建设提供了有力支持。
标签: #分布式存储有哪些特征
评论列表